This dataset contains the integrated input parameters used for modelling the South African electricity sector from 2020 to 2050. The data is organized into two primary spreadsheets:

  • Demand Modelling (MAED): Contains the socio-economic and technical input parameters used to generate long-term electricity demand projections. These projections serve as the demand-side basis for the supply-side modelling.
  • Supply-Side Modelling (OSeMOSYS): Includes techno-economic data and assumptions for the South African electricity sector.

This work is funded by the Climate Compatible Growth Programme.
